Support for family and friends of people with a substance use disorder

HOUGHTON — Addiction is a disease that impacts everyone around the addicted person. At Dial Help, we are now offering community presentations at businesses, agencies, and other groups in the UP through our new Affected Others Program. The goal is to educate friends and family of people with addiction so they better know how to both support their loved one and take care of themselves.

“Family and friends of people who struggle with an addiction can be affected in many ways including emotionally, financially, and legally,” said Mandy Daniels, Affected Others Coordinator. “This is why it’s so important to provide resources and support to those who are affected by a loved one’s substance use disorder.”

The program also offers referral to resources for anyone in the community who is struggling with addiction, or have a loved one with addiction.
